If the acceleration due to gravity suddenly disappears at a point in its journey, the body will continue to move with the velocity it had at that instant. The force of gravity is responsible for the acceleration of a freely falling body, and if that force is removed, the body will no longer experience acceleration due to gravity.

In the absence of other forces (such as air resistance or friction), the body will move with a constant velocity. This constant velocity could be zero (meaning the body comes to rest) or a non-zero value, depending on the velocity the body had at the moment gravity disappeared.
